النساء · Verse 20 / 176 · Page 81
ۚ وَإِنْ أَرَدتُّمُ اسْتِبْدَالَ زَوْجٍ مَّكَانَ زَوْجٍ وَآتَيْتُمْ إِحْدَاهُنَّ قِنطَارًا فَلَا تَأْخُذُوا مِنْهُ شَيْئًا أَتَأْخُذُونَهُ بُهْتَانًا وَإِثْمًا مُّبِينًا
Wa in arattumustib daala zawjim makaana zawjin wa aataitum ihdaahunna qintaaran falaa taakhuzoo minhu shai'aa; ataakhuzoonahoo buhtaannanw wa ismam mubeenaa
But if you want to replace one wife with another and you have given one of them a great amount [in gifts], do not take [back] from it anything. Would you take it in injustice and manifest sin?
If you want to divorce a woman and replace her with another, then you are allowed to do so; but if you gave the one you intend to divorce a great deal of wealth as a dowry, then you are not allowed to take anything back from it. Taking back what you gave to them would be an injustice and a clear sin.
Source: Al-Mukhtasar Tafsir — Tafsir Center for Quranic Studies.
